Finding 'The Adults' online for free can be tricky, but I totally get the urge to dive into a good book without breaking the bank. I've stumbled upon a few sites like Project Gutenberg or Open Library that sometimes have older titles, but 'The Adults' might be too recent. If you're into ebooks, checking out your local library's digital catalog is a solid move—they often partner with apps like Libby or Hoopla.

Just a heads-up, though: if you're scouring sketchy sites promising free downloads, be careful. Pirated copies can be risky with malware, and supporting authors by buying their work or borrowing legally feels way better in the long run. Maybe keep an eye out for sales or Kindle deals too!

Where can I read young adult novels to read for free online?

4 Answers2025-07-16 18:35:15
I've scoured the internet for the best free reading spots. Project Gutenberg is a goldmine for classics like 'Little Women' and 'Anne of Green Gables,' all legally free since they're in the public domain. For newer titles, sites like Wattpad and Royal Road offer a treasure trove of indie YA stories, from fantasy romances to dystopian adventures. Many aspiring authors post their work here, and some even gain massive followings before getting published. Libraries are another fantastic resource, even online. Platforms like OverDrive and Libby let you borrow ebooks and audiobooks with just a library card. Some libraries even partner with services like Hoopla for instant access. If you're into manga or light novels, websites like Webnovel or Babelnovel often have free chapters of popular series. Just be cautious with unofficial sites—stick to legal options to support authors.

Are there any free classic novels to read online for adults?

3 Answers2025-12-08 09:32:10
Exploring the world of classic literature online is such a joy, especially when there are so many amazing options available for free! Project Gutenberg is a fantastic resource; it offers over 60,000 free eBooks, including timeless works like 'Pride and Prejudice' by Jane Austen and 'Moby Dick' by Herman Melville. I’ve spent many evenings lost in the pages of these novels, often finding new insights or simply appreciating the beautiful prose. It feels rewarding to dive into the minds of authors from centuries past, experiencing their unique views on life and society. Another gem is the Internet Archive, which not only houses a wide variety of classic novels but also timeless novels and obscure works that you may have never heard of! I recently stumbled upon 'The Secret Garden' by Frances Hodgson Burnett there, and it reminded me of the magic in nurturing not just a garden but also relationships. It's amazing how these stories transcend time and continue to resonate with readers from different walks of life. There’s a certain charm in connecting with something that has been cherished for decades! Last but not least, many local libraries have transitioned to providing free digital resources. With a library card, you can access countless eBooks through apps like Libby and OverDrive. I often use these apps to borrow classics, ensuring that I always have a fresh read in my pocket, whether it’s 'The Picture of Dorian Gray' by Oscar Wilde or 'The Great Gatsby' by F. Scott Fitzgerald. So, definitely consider diving into these platforms; they open up a treasure trove of literature.
